Understanding the "Blacken" Modification:
Before diving into the specifics, it's crucial to clarify the term "Blacken" in relation to the Rolex Submariner. The term doesn't refer to an official Rolex model. Instead, it likely signifies a modification or customization process, potentially undertaken by a third-party company like "Blaken" (as suggested by the provided information). This process typically involves applying a Diamond-Like Carbon (DLC) coating to the stainless steel bracelet and potentially other components, resulting in a durable, matte black finish. It's important to remember that such modifications void the original Rolex warranty. However, some third-party modifiers, like the hypothetical "Blaken," may offer their own warranty on their modifications. This is a critical distinction to make when considering the purchase of a "Blacken" Rolex Submariner.
